A Message for Ryu from Maestro Lorin Maazel when he played under his baton in 2007:
“Ryu Goto is a sterling violinist with impeccable technical credentials and a personal musical flair. He has rightfully taken his place among the top echelon of today's young performers. I do hope to re-engage Ryu at sometime in the future.”
A Message for Ryu from Maestro Myung Whun Chung when Ryu made a contract with Deutsche Grammophon in 2005:
"I have watched the extraordinary progress of this gifted young artist and having by now performed with him as both conductor and pianist this last year I have been much impressed by his qualities as both brilliant virtuoso and growing young musician. DG is fortunate to have signed him at this early stage in what will certainly be an exciting career."
A Message for Ryu from
Maestro Vladimir Ashkenazy when Ryu made a contract with Deutsche Grammophon in 2005:
“When Ryu Goto first played for me a few years ago I was delighted to discover such a fresh and spontaneous talent and an obviously devoted and communicative young artist. Since then we have performed together with the Philharmonia Orchestra, and I am delighted that we have performed so again in Washington in November this year with the National Symphony and on tour with the European Union Youth Orchestra in April 2006. I congratulate him – and Deutsche Grammophon – on the signing of this most auspicious recording contract.”
